Gas pain may occur if gas is trapped or not moving well through your digestive system. Gas pain in the chest can result from food intolerances or indigestion. An increase in gas or gas pain may result from eating. But chest pain with other symptoms, such as shortness of breath, may indicate a more serious condition.
